Shaheed Creates Dangerous Field-Stretching Threat
- Rashid Shaheed adds genuine deep-threat spacing that forces defenses to play safer and opens the underneath game for Seattle.
- His speed strains coverage even when he doesn't touch the ball, improving Sam Darnold's passing lanes.
Scheme Fit Accelerates Shaheed's Impact
- Shaheed's familiarity with Clint Kubiak smooths his integration and accelerates impact in Seattle's scheme.
- Coaches using him consistently downfield will immediately alter opposing coverages.
Two Firsts For A Corner Is Risky Valuation
- Trading Sauce Gardner for two first-round picks is understandable for the Jets but feels like an overpay from the Colts' side.
- Elite corners change games, but Sherman questions paying two firsts for a corner without guaranteed interception production.
